HEPHZIBAH, Ga. - Mr. Arthur Lee (Meatball) Parks, 59, of 4875 Old Waynesboro Road, died on Sunday, June 8, 2014 at his residence. He was born in Edgefield County SC, son of the late Addie Parks Cartledge and Rufus Cartledge. He was a member of the Liberty Spring Baptist Church. He is survived by: daughter, Angela Tina (Burdell) Mason, Greenwood, SC; his father and stepmother, Rufus and Opal Cartledge, Washington, DC; three brothers, Dexter (Mary) Cartledge, Hephzibah, GA and Clarence E. Parks, Indianola, Miss., Anthony (Carolyn) Cartledge, Washington, DC; three sisters, Angela (Michael) Parks, Washington, DC, Antoneita (Ron) Parham, Richmond, VA and Antonelle Cartledge, Upper Marlboro, MD; three grandchildren, four great grandchildren; and other relatives and friends. Funeral services will be 12 noon, Saturday, June 14, 2014 at the Liberty Spring Baptist Church with burial in the church cemetery. The body will be placed in the church at 11 a.m. Condolence may be sent to www.butlerandsonsfuneralhome.com Butler & Sons Funeral Home, Saluda, SC, is assisting the Parks family.
